Why is my printer is printing blank pages

We recently moved offices and my printer is now giving me problems. It will print 1 or 2 good pages (different documents) and then goes to printing blank pages for the next few documents. Feeds paper through and acts/sounds like it's printing but the pages are blank. I've uninstalled & reinstalled the printer drive, disconnected everything and reconnected, several restarts and shut offs. I cannot find any rhyme or reason to when it decides to quit working. The ink cartridges did not need replacing. And as I said, I will get a good page once in a while. Any thoughts on what to check?

Printer Printing blank page issue can be occurred when you have low or dried ink cartridge, blocked nozzles, dirty print head and ink cartridge installed improperly. Follow the troubleshooting steps to fix printer printing blank pages:


·Restart the printer
·Check printer ink cartridge
·Clean the printer print head
·Update the printer drivers

SOURCE: HP IIIp prints extra blank pages

HI there make sure that the paper tray guides are fully against the paper also try sending the job through the manual feed to see if you get the same problem. If you do not then it maybe that the paper cassette separation pad is worn and will need replacing. If your model has no rubber pad at the front of the cassette then you will have a metal hold over one corner of the paper make sure that when the paper lifts that the paper sits under the silver (Dog Ear) as this acts as a separator.

I just figured out my issue. It had to do with DEP − Data Execution
Prevention. I had remembered that I was fooling around with this a couple
weeks ago and had changed it to "Turn on DEP for all programs and services
except those I select" in which I had Windows Explorer checked. I just got
done selecting the original which states "Turn on DEP for essential Windows
programs and services only", rebooted, and now I can print again to my hp
7350 printer.
The DEP can be found under control panel−>system−>Advanced Tab−>Performance
Settings−>Data Execution Prevention Tab

SOURCE: Printer feeds blank pages.

often in the Printer properties, there is a tickbox, to feed a blank sheet between print jobs. this is to assist in keeping print jobs seperated on busy printers.

Here is the way to change the setting on a single print job:

  1. Click the Start button
  2. Point to Settings
  3. Point to Printers (Windows 2000) or Printers and Faxes (Windows XP).
  4. Right-click the HP LaserJet driver you plan to use (2420)
  5. Click Properties .
  6. On the Advanced tab, uncheck Separator Page.
  7. Click OK to return to the Advanced tab.
  8. Click OK to save the settings.
Making the change a permanent thing For All print Jobs on this printer:
  1. Click the Start button.
  2. Point to Settings .
  3. Point to Printers (Windows 2000) or Printers and Faxes (Windows XP).
  4. Right-click the HP Printer you want to correct the settings to.
  5. Click Properties .
  6. On the Advanced tab, click Printing Defaults .
  7. Change any of the settings on the tabs. These settings become the defaults for the printer.
  8. Click OK to return to the Advanced tab.
  9. Click OK to save the settings and to close the printer driver.

Printer problems can be a real hassle.
From time to time, due to document layout or settings on your computer, in your software of choice, or even on your printer, a blank page may get "printed" with the rest of your document.
Fortunately, this issue is a simple one to troubleshoot.
Click "Print Preview" when you are finished with your document and ready to print.
Observe your document.
If you see an extra, blank page, you have created a second page.
To delete the second page, close Print Preview, go back into the document and eliminate any blank lines in your documents that you may not need.
You may also find an inadvertent page break at the end of your document.
Place your cursor on its symbol and delete it.
Locate the symbol by clicking on the Show Formatting paragraph icon in the toolbar.


Circumvent this "ghost page" if you do not see a second (or additional) blank page in Print Preview.

Specify the number of pages you wish to print, within the Print dialogue box.
This is typically done by selecting the "Print From" option, then entering the page numbers desired.
If your document happens to be ten pages (without, of course, that final blank page), then enter in the "Print From" field the numbers "1-10".
This will print only pages 1 through 10, without an eleventh (blank) page.

Type just one or two words in a new document and try to print. Before printing, look at the print setup and make sure you have the correct printer name selected.
Also when you go to print, there are few options like:

  • Print All
  • Current page
  • Pages
  • Selection
If you attempt to print "selection" without actually selecting a certain portion of the document, you get blank page.
So first check that the correct name of the printer is selected.
